Major Ryan Mohler

Major Ryan Mohler graduated from the University of Hawaii Manoa in 2008 with a Bachelor of Science degree in Kinesiology, and in May 2008 was subsequently commissioned a Second Lieutenant in the Marine Corps.  He graduated The Basic School, Quantico, Virginia in July 2009 and obtained the Aviation Supply Officer Military Occupational Specialty.
 
After graduation from The Basic School, he was assigned to Marine Aviation Logistics Squadron 14 (MALS-14) to begin on the job training.  In August, 2008 he was assigned to Naval Supply Corps School, Athens, Georgia where he completed the Aviation Supply Officer Basic Qualification Course.  Upon his return to MALS-14, he filled multiple division OICs billets within the Aviation Supply Department.  From August 2011 to February 2012, he deployed to Kandahar Airfield as the MALS-40 Detachment B OIC, where he oversaw the Marine aviation logistical support for the AV-8B and C-130J aircraft.  Upon his return, he assumed the billet of Assistant Aviation Supply Officer until his EAS in May 2012.
 
In June 2012, he assessed onto the Active Reserve program and was assigned as the Assistant Aviation Supply Officer, 4th Marine Aircraft Wing, Marine Corps Support Facility New Orleans.
 
In June 2015, he assumed responsibilities as the Reserve Procurement Officer, Marine Corps Recruiting Command in Quantico, Virginia.  During this time, he deployed as an individual augmentee to Headquarters, Resolute Support under the Deputy Chief of Staff-Support, CJ4 in Kabul, Afghanistan.  Upon his return, he again assumed the responsibilities as the Reserve Procurement Officer until July 2019.
 
In July 2019, he reported to MCRD Parris Island, SC for duty as the Prior Service Recruiting Branch Head, Assistant Chief of Staff Recruiting, Eastern Recruiting Region.  In July 2022, he assumed the responsibilities as the Prior Service Recruiting Station 12, Officer in Charge, 12th Marine Corps District.
 
His personal awards include the Joint Service Commendation Medal with “C” device, Navy and Marine Corps Commendation Medal with one gold star, and Navy and Marine Corps Achievement Medal with one gold star.
